Sinopsis

"Sarcasm Impact" explores the intricate world of sarcasm, a communication tool capable of fostering connection or creating division. The book delves into the linguistic and psychological underpinnings of sarcasm, examining how vocal tone, facial expressions, and context contribute to its interpretation. Sarcasm isn't merely a biting remark; it's a sophisticated form of communication that plays a significant role in social dynamics. Did you know, for example, that sarcasm can be used to convey criticism indirectly or to establish group identity? This book uniquely integrates research from linguistics, psychology, and sociology to provide a comprehensive understanding of sarcasm's impact on social interaction. It examines the core components of sarcasm, addresses its societal implications across different cultures, and analyzes its influence on workplace dynamics and interpersonal relationships. The book progresses from defining sarcasm and its key components to exploring the role of context and social functions, concluding with strategies for improving sarcastic communication and reducing misunderstandings.

    World War II was fought on a scale unlike anything before or since in human history, and the unfathomable casualty counts are attributable in large measure to the carnage inflicted between Nazi Germany and the Soviet Union during Hitler’s invasion of Russia and Stalin’s desperate defense. The invasion came in 1941 following a nonaggression pact signed between the two in 1939, which allowed Hitler to focus his attention on the west without having to worry about an attack from the eastern front. While Germany was focusing on the west, the Soviet Union sent large contingents of troops to the border region between the two countries, and Stalin’s plan to take territory in Poland and the Baltic States angered Hitler. By 1940, Hitler viewed Stalin as a major threat and had made the decision to invade Russia: “In the course of this contest, Russia must be disposed of...Spring 1941. The quicker we smash Russia the better.”  
    Stalin knew that if he could delay an invasion through the summer of 1941, he would be safe for another year, but Hitler began to plan to invade Russia by May of 1941. Since military secrets are typically the hardest to keep, Stalin soon began to hear rumors of the invasion, but even when Winston Churchill contacted him in April of 1941 warning him that German troops seemed to be massing on Russia’s border, Stalin remained dubious. Stalin felt even more secure in his position when the Germans failed to invade the following May.   
    The Soviets were so caught by surprise at the start of the attack that the Germans were able to push several hundred miles into Russia across a front that stretched dozens of miles long, reaching the major cities of Leningrad and Sevastopol in just three months. In order to make clear his determination to win at all costs, Stalin had the three men in charge of the troops defending Minsk executed for their failure to hold their position.
